Arenite (English spelling) arenite, arenyte
Consolidated or lithified sand containing less than 15% matrix material. Composition is designated by appropriate prefixes such as calcarenite or silicarenite [Grabau: 1904, 1920, Pettijohn, et al .: 1975].
